摘要: An endoscope apparatus includes a display portion coupled to an operation portion, configured to be moved relative to the operation portion and configured to display an observation image obtained by the endoscope apparatus, a bending operation portion provided at the operation portion and configured to be moved in a basic direction relative to the operation portion wherein the bending operation portion is configured to be moved in an additional direction different from the basic direction, and a movement driving mechanism configured to move the display portion relative to the operation portion according to movement of the bending operation portion in the additional direction relative to the operation portion.

摘要: An endoscope includes an operation portion, an optical image conducting member arranged in the inner space of the operation portion, a display portion coupled to the operation portion so as to be movable relative to the operation portion, an electric connecting member extending between the inner spaces of the operation portion and the display portion and connected to the display portion, and a restricting mechanism configured to restrict movement of a part forming a play in the electric connecting member toward the optical image conducting member, and the restricting mechanism includes a wound portion provided in the inner space, a winding portion being a part of the electric connecting member and wound around the wound portion to form the play, and a winding portion receiving portion provided in the inner space, arranged between the winding portion and the optical image conducting member and configured to support the winding portion.

摘要: An inserting portion has, at the proximal end thereof, an operating portion having a bending lever for bending operation. The operating portion has, on the front end side thereof, a grip portion gripped by an operator. The grip portion has therein a plate frame as an internal structure for ensuring predetermined strength. At the notch portion formed by partly notching the frame, an image pick-up unit is mounted to form an optical image transmitted by image guiding fibers to a CCD via a relay optical system. The image pick-up unit is fixed to the frame via an attaching member. Thus, predetermined strength is assured and the image pick-up unit is compactly accommodated with simple structure. A predetermined image pick-up function using the image pick-up unit is held without the action of high tension to the image guiding fibers by mounting a bending portion to the image guiding fibers.

摘要: A surgical microscope apparatus incorporating a frame portion placed on a floor, a microscope body for stereoscopically observing a portion to be operated, an arm portion supported by the frame portion and arranged to suspend the microscope body, and an endoscope for observing a blind spot for a stereoscopic observation field of view. The frame portion has a light source unit for generating light for illuminating a portion observed with the endoscope and a camera control unit for processing an observed image of an observed portion obtained by the endoscope. A light guide fiber extending from the light source unit to the microscope body and capable of supplying light to the endoscope, and a camera cable for transmitting the image observed with the endoscope to the camera control unit extend in the arm portion. The microscope body is provided with an end of the light guide fiber for connecting the endoscope and a camera head connected to the camera cable.
